The Allure of Temptation and Wealth

Lithe's song "Tempt Me" delves into the seductive and often perilous world of wealth, temptation, and personal relationships. The lyrics paint a vivid picture of a lifestyle filled with luxury and excess, symbolized by high-end brands like Chanel, LV, and Fendi, and the presence of a Benz. This opulence is juxtaposed with the internal struggle of maintaining one's values and integrity amidst the allure of materialism and temptation. The recurring theme of being tempted by a "shorty" suggests a relationship dynamic that is both enticing and potentially destructive, akin to the infamous partnership of Bonnie and Clyde.

The song also explores the theme of trust and the challenges it presents in a fast-paced, money-driven world. The artist expresses a sense of vulnerability and the difficulty of maintaining trust, as indicated by lines like "Trust just ain't my forte." This sentiment is further emphasized by the mention of "demons," which could symbolize personal struggles or external pressures that threaten to derail one's path. The lyrics suggest a life lived on the edge, where weekdays blend into weekends, and the thrill of the "deep end" is ever-present.

Ultimately, "Tempt Me" is a reflection on the duality of desire and the consequences of succumbing to it. The imagery of "wheels fall off, hearts gone cold" and "'til the tank on empty" conveys a sense of inevitable decline if one continues down this path. The song serves as a cautionary tale about the seductive power of wealth and the importance of staying grounded amidst life's temptations, urging listeners to trust in something greater while navigating their own personal challenges.
